Salaires et charges de personnel

In 2024, Saint-Égrève spent 18.5 M€ on this. That is 67% of its operations.

Against towns of the same size

+12.8 pt Saint-Égrève devotes 66.8%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 10,000 to 20,000 inhabitants is 54%.

Ranked 3 of 520 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€1,072, against €688 for the median (+56 %).
